Is the saying, "I have believed in the Holy Qur’an and everything revealed therein, and everything mentioned therein, and in its rulings, and every word in the Holy Qur’an, and every letter therein," permissible and valid?

1 min readAlso available in العربية

This phrase is correct in meaning, but its wording is not authentically transmitted and contains artificiality and redundancy. It is sufficient for a believer to say: "I have believed in the Book of Allah," as stated in the Hadith of Al-Bara' bin 'Azib: "I have believed in Your Book which You revealed and in Your Prophet whom You sent."
